What is actually transforming for vuejs developers in 2023 #.\n\n2022 found some significant adjustments in the Vue.js ecosystem coming from Vue 3 becoming the brand new default Vue model, to advancement atmospheres turning to Vite, to a secure release of Nuxt 3. What do all these improvements, as well as others, suggest for Vue.js devs in 2023?\nAllow's consider what the upcoming year may keep.\nVue 3.\nEarly in the year, Vue model 3 ended up being the brand-new main nonpayment. This denotes completion of a period for Vue 2, and also indicates many of the existing Vue jobs out there require to consider an upgrade very soon, if they have not already. While numerous staffs were actually prevented coming from upgrading because of neighborhood packages dragging in Vue 3 assistance, lots of well-known package deals are currently compatible.\nSeveral of these preferred packages that now sustain Vue 3 include: Vuetify, VueFire, and also Vee-Validate.\nComposition API.\nAlong with Vue 3 as the brand new nonpayment, it is actually ending up being a growing number of typical for programmers to go all in with the Structure API. By that, I suggest making use of the Make-up API certainly not merely for shareable composables and\/or for huge components for far better company, yet additionally in day-to-day component progression.\nThis is reflected in the main doctors, in addition to in numerous post, video tutorials, public library docs, and extra. I anticipate to find this style proceed. Script configuration makes using the Compositon API all over feasible and also even exciting. Plus, it helps make including third event composables much easier and also helps make extracting your very own composables much more instinctive.\nOn this very same details, certainly expect 3rd celebration public libraries to subject performance predominantly using composables (with possibilities API user interfaces or practical elements offered second top priority, if consisted of whatsoever). VueUse is a terrific instance of just how powerful plug-and-play composables may be!\nTypeScript.\nOne more trend I view increasing in 2023, is using TypeScript to develop huge incrustation (and also also some little incrustation) applications. After all Vue 3 itself is actually constructed with TS. The formal scaffolding for Vue 3 (npm init vue) provides a simple swift for TS arrangement and also Nuxt 3 supports it by nonpayment. This reduced barrier for entry are going to indicate additional developers giving it a twist.\nMoreover, if you want to publish a high quality plugin in 2023 you'll certainly intend to accomplish this in TypeScript. This creates it less complicated for the bundle consumers to socialize along with your code, as a result of improved autocompletion\/intellisense and mistake diagnosis.\nCondition Management along with Pinia.\nIn preparation for a brand new model of Vuex, Eduardo San Martin Morote as well as Kia Master Ishii try out a new state management public library phoned Pinia. Currently Pinia changes Vuex as the formal state administration service for Vue. This adjustment is undoubtedly an upgrade. Pinia is without a number of the extra ponderous and also perplexing absorptions from Vuex (ie. anomalies, origin establishment vs elements, and so on), is actually more instinctive to make use of (it believes much like simple ol' JavaScript), as well as supports TypeScript out-of-the-box.\nWhile Vuex is actually not going anywhere anytime very soon, I definitely forecast several tasks will certainly help make migrating from the old to the brand new a top priority, because programmer expertise. If you need to have help with the method, our team have a write-up devoted to the movement topic on the Vue Institution blog and there's additionally a page in the formal Pinia docs to aid with the process.\nSuper Quick Growth along with Vite.\nIn my opinion, Vite is actually probably one of the innovations with the largest influence on Vue growth this year. It's lightning quick dev web server zero hour as well as HMR certainly suggest faster feedback loops, enhanced DX, and enhanced performance. For those jobs that are actually still working on Vue-CLI\/webpack, I visualize teams are going to invest a little bit of attend 2023 shifting to Vite.\nWhile the process looks a little different every task (as well as definitely a bit much more entailed when personalized webpack configs are interested), our company have a useful article on the Vue Institution blog post that walks you with the standard method bit by bit. For most tasks, it ought to be a fairly simple process but even for those even more complex setups that take a little bit more time, the benefit is actually effectively worth the attempt.\nAdditionally, besides the center service, Vite has actually given rise to a variety of complimentary solutions including Vitest (a zero-config screening service for Vite) as well as Vite PWA.\nNuxt 3.\nS\u00e9bastien Chopin revealed the launch of a steady Nuxt 3 at Nuxt Nation only last week. The most recent version comes with some remarkable upgrades like hybrid making, Vue 3 assistance, api courses, and also a lot more! Along with the rise of the make-up API, I find Nuxt being actually additional used even in jobs that don't need hosting server side making. Why? Given that the auto-imported components, composables, as well as energies alone produce cleaner part reports as well as strengthened DX.\nFor projects that perform require server side making, I see Nuxt being used more often as an all-in-one option, since it right now features server API paths as well as may be run nearly anywhere (yes, even in serverless feature on platforms like Netlify and also Vercel!).\nBesides conventional universal making, where total webpages are actually moistened in the client, additionally look for methods to minimize the quantity of JS downloaded in Nuxt 3. The transfer to low JS and also platforms like Remix with the call to
useThePlatform will certainly possess their influence.More to Watch On.These forecasts and also monitorings are actually just a few of the things to await. There are still plenty a lot more that deserve briefly pointing out.Keep an eye on Nuxt Studio for handling your website information in the internet browser.The Nuxt 3 expands possibility is actually an encouraging feature that just could revolutionize the technique we discuss parts, composables, concepts, etc around tasks.pnpm is becoming ever before extra well-known for package control and also possesses built-in help for mono-repos. Consider subsitituing it for npm or even anecdote in your following task.The UnJS company on Github is actually building a lot of incredibly appealing software applications to assist you build JS jobs that can manage anywhere. It electrical powers a deal of the Nuxt 3 structure.Packages that are actually developed from scratch for Vue 3 are offering some competitve conveniences over similar solutions that you could actually fit with coming from utilizing in Vue 2. In my viewpoint, some examples of these consist of: FormKit, Histoire, and also VueUse.Cause 2023.The adjustments generated in 2022 have actually poised 2023 to be a terrific year for the present day Vue.js developer. At Vue University, our experts are actually cognizant of these progressions in the environment as well as are definitely creating online video and written web content to encourage you wherefore is actually ahead.! Our experts currently have training programs committed to teaching you.Vite, VueUse, Pinia, TypeScript for Vue.js, the Make-up API, FormKit, Vitest, and even Nuxt 3! Rest assured our company'll carry on tracking the patterns as well as the services most effectively suitable for your Vue.js apps as well as routine our material correctly.Therefore, I say, bring on 2023! As well as I want an efficient year for you and your Vue.js functions.